  1. CapgrasDelusion By: Bryce Sebben

  2. Joseph Capgras • French Psychiatrist • 1923- he described what he called a form of non-schizophrenic paranoid psychosis. • It was given the name Délire d’interprétation de Sérieux et Capgras.

  3. Capgras Delusion • Delusion-a belief held with strong conviction despite superior evidence to the contrary. • Not a hallucination

  4. Primary Delusion • People think family and friends are replaced by an imposter. • Some cases are more extreme than others

  5. Secondary Delusions • Sometimes it’s not just a loved one. • Pets • Objects • Even yourself

  6. Causes • Stroke • Drug overdose • Cerebral lesions caused by head injury

  7. Interesting facts • Doctors have to rule out 8 different diseases before being able to think about diagnosing you with capgras syndrome. • The person may only think one person or object is replaced and everything else about them is normal
